## Description You can now tell bottom which column the process widget should be sorted by at startup, instead of always falling back to CPU%. It's settable in two places: a `default_sort` field under `[processes]` in the config file, and a `--process_default_sort` CLI flag. The flag accepts the same column-name aliases that already work in `[processes].columns` (e.g. `cpu%`, `mem`, `pid`, `name`, `read`, `t.write`, etc.), and the CLI flag wins over the config setting. ```toml [processes] default_sort = "mem" ``` ``` btm --process_default_sort mem ``` This piggybacks on the same wiring that #2003 added for the disk and temperature widgets, just routed through the existing `ProcTableConfig` so the widget initializer can pick a non-default sort index without touching any of the runtime sort code. A few small things worth flagging: - If the configured column is not actually present in the user's `columns` list, the widget falls back to the existing default behaviour (CPU% in normal/grouped mode, PID in tree mode) instead of silently snapping to column 0. That keeps misconfiguration predictable. - The deserializer for `ProcColumn` was refactored to share its parsing with the CLI's value parser, so config-file and CLI accept the exact same aliases. The set of accepted strings is unchanged from before. Extended Documentation
This is where the extended documentation resides, hosted on GitHub Pages. We use MkDocs, Material for MkDocs, and mike.
Documentation is currently built using Python 3.11, though it should work fine with older versions.
Running locally
One way is to just run serve.sh. Alternatively, the manual steps are, assuming your current working directory
is the bottom repo:
# Change directories to the documentation.
cd docs/
# Create and activate venv.
python -m venv venv
source venv/bin/activate
# Install requirements
pip install -r requirements.txt
# Run mkdocs
venv/bin/mkdocs serve
Deploying
Deploying is done via mike in order to get versioning. Typically, this is done through CI, but can be done manually if needed.
Nightly docs
cd docs
mike deploy nightly --push
Stable docs
cd docs
# Rename the previous stable version
mike retitle --push stable $OLD_STABLE_VERSION
# Set the newest version as the most recent stable version
mike deploy --push --update-aliases $RELEASE_VERSION stable
# Append a "(stable)" string to the end.
mike retitle --push $RELEASE_VERSION "$RELEASE_VERSION (stable)"
